How AI skin testing works step by step

The technical process is transparent to the end user, but understanding it maximises the results:

1. Photographic capture

The app normalises the lighting, eliminating shadows and correcting colour temperature automatically. You need a photo without make-up, in diffused natural light, 30 cm from your face.

2. Parameter processing

The algorithm segments your face into 12 technical zones (forehead, periorbital, T-zone, etc.). Evaluates dilated pores, texture, hyperpigmentation, elasticity, vascular vs. pigmented dark circles.

3. Dermatologically based comparison

Your image is cross-checked against databases of 30,000+ clinically diagnosed faces, including different phototypes (Fitzpatrick I-VI) and ethnicities.

4. Report generation

You receive a score 0-100 for each facial area and an executive report with priorities:

"T-zone hydration: 67/100 - urgent improvement.

5. Recommendation of ingredients

Not just products, but specific molecules: “low molecular weight hyaluronic acid + niacinamide at 5%”.”

Professional tip: always scan at the same time (recommended: 10h-12h) and menstrual cycle phase for comparable data.

How to integrate AI into your current beauty routine without fuss

Phase 1: Initial scan and audit

Upload your photo to AI Skin Scanner. Generate a report and list your current products.
Immediate action: eliminates duplicate products (e.g.: two vitamin C serums).

Phase 2: progressive replacement

Don't buy everything at once. Prioritise according to the algorithm: if your score of hydrolipidic barrier <60/100, start with a moisturiser with ceramides.
Wait 21 days before adding the next one.

Phase 3: photographic follow-up

Set weekly reminders. Always take the photo at 10h, without make-up and with diffused light.
The AI will generate a evolution graph that validates whether the routine works.

Phase 4: Monthly reassessment

Adjusts according to climate: in Lanzarote, e.g., humidity varies by 45% between seasons.
More light textures in summer, more occlusives in winter.
